About this experience

Experience the magic of Marrakech at sunrise on a peaceful hot air balloon flight over the Atlas Mountains. After an early morning hotel pickup, enjoy a smooth and safe flight with a licensed pilot as the landscape below glows with golden and rose colors. Upon landing, relax with an authentic Berber breakfast served in a private tent, making this a once-in-a-lifetime and stress-free experience. What you'll see and do

  1. Marrakech

    Door-to-door pickup from your Marrakech accommodation in comfortable vehicle. Exact time confirmed via WhatsApp by 6 PM previous day (typically 4:30-6:00 AM depending on season).

    30 minutes here

  2. Palmeraie

    Launch Site Arrival - Palmeraie Desert Watch our crew inflate the hot air balloon while enjoying complimentary mint tea, coffee, and Moroccan pastries. Safety briefing from your licensed pilot. Perfect opportunity to photograph the burners lighting up the balloon canopy at dawn.

    30 minutes here

  3. Palmeraie

    Take off at sunrise for a peaceful hot air balloon flight over Marrakech’s desert landscapes, palm groves, Berber villages, and open countryside, with beautiful views of the Atlas Mountains in the distance. Flight time is planned for approximately 40-60 minutes, but may be shorter or longer depending on wind, weather, landing conditions, and safety requirements. Your pilot shares local insights during the flight, with plenty of time for photos from the basket.

    50 minutes here

  4. Palmeraie

    Traditional Berber Breakfast - Desert Camp After smooth landing, celebrate with flight certificate presentation. Then enjoy authentic Moroccan breakfast under a traditional tent: mint tea, msemen pancakes, local honey, olives, cheese, eggs, fresh juice, and warm bread.

    30 minutes here

  5. Marrakech

    Return Transfer - Marrakech Comfortable return transport to your original pickup location in Marrakech, arriving around 9:00-9:30 AM with time to enjoy the rest of your day.

    30 minutes here

Know before you go

  • Public transportation options are available nearby
  • Not recommended for travelers with spinal injuries
  • Not recommended for pregnant travelers
  • Not recommended for travelers with poor cardiovascular health
  • Travelers should have at least a moderate level of physical fitness
  • Maximum weight per passenger: 120 kg; minimum age: 6 years
